机器视觉哪种软件比较好(机器视觉软件排名)

kuaidi.ping-jia.net  作者:佚名   更新日期:2024-07-03

1、以Halcon,VisionPro为代表的传统机器视觉软件,通过调用各种算法因子,针对目标特征,定制化设置各种参数。其擅长解决以测量为主的定量问题,和判断有无的简单问题,但对复杂检测类的需求,漏检率/误检率较高。虽然软件价格一降再降,国产软件售价仅几千元甚至免费,但前期开发和后期维护成本较高,在使用时面临很大的局限性。

2、以康耐视的VIDI、Sualab(已被康耐视收购)为代表的深度学习软件,将深度学习的标注、训练、测试流程,以PC软件的方式进行封装,降低了用户使用深度学习技术的门槛。主要解决传统视觉无法解决的复杂缺陷检测难题,或用深度学习的标注方法,提高开发效率。但从实际应用效果来看,当前的深度学习主要以监督学习为主,针对不同场景,需要大量的模型选择、调参等工作,无法针对所有场景,通用性的解决,因此,并没有解决传统算法需要定制开发的难题,并且用户的使用门槛较高,普通工程师对深度学习的调参一般没有基础。

3、北京矩视智能科技有限公司,成立于2017年,先后获融资近千万元,创新性的提供了一款云端的工业视觉深度学习工具,线上实现标注、训练、测试流程,依靠在云端积累的大量不同场景的深度学习模型库,用户上传、标注图片后,将由云端自动匹配最优的深度学习模型和参数进行训练,用户无需任何操作,线上测试效果后,下载SDK即可本地化运行,真正做到通用级的工业视觉深度学习工具。同时在商业上,矩视智能将云端工具直接免费,下载sdk后,仅需购买Lisence加密狗,即可本地运行,致力于将深度学习技术应用于所有的工业视觉场景中。



随着信号处理理论和计算机技术的发展,人们试图用摄像机获取环境图像并将其转换成数字信号,用计算机实现对视觉信息处理的全过程,这样就形成了一门新兴的学科———计算机视觉。计算机视觉的研究目标是使计算机具有通过一幅或多幅图像认知周围环境信息的能力。这使计算机不仅能模拟人眼的功能,而且更重要的是使计算机完成人眼所不能胜任的工作。机器视觉则是建立在计算机视觉理论的基础上,偏重于计算机视觉技术工程化。与计算机视觉研究的视觉模式识别、视觉理解等内容不同,机器视觉重点在于感知环境中物体的形状、位置、姿态、运动等几何信息。

  • 机器视觉软件分享
    答:1. 免费的SGVision:无编程的视觉解决方案 SGVision,这款在马克拉伯官网可轻松获取的软件,是机器视觉领域的瑰宝。马克拉伯社区为会员提供了这款免费的机器视觉应用,无需任何编程基础,数百种预先设计的算法直接可用。它能快速解决90%的视觉项目问题,无论是缺陷检测、外观评估、尺寸测量,还是视觉定位引导、...
  • 机器视觉方面有哪些好的开发平台,各有什么特点?
    答:1. MVTec HALCON:这是一个功能强大的商业机器视觉软件平台,以其高性能和可靠性著称,适用于各种复杂的视觉任务。它提供了广泛的工具和算法,并且支持多种编程语言进行二次开发。2. OpenCV:作为一个开源的计算机视觉和机器学习软件库,OpenCV拥有丰富的图像处理和视觉算法。它广泛应用于学术和商业领域,...
  • 机器视觉哪种软件比较好(机器视觉软件排名)
    答:1. 传统机器视觉软件,如Halcon和VisionPro,通过调用算法因子并针对目标特征定制化设置参数,擅长解决测量和简单判断问题。然而,在复杂检测任务中,这类软件的漏检率和误检率较高。尽管软件价格不断下降,国产软件甚至售价仅几千元或免费,但前期开发和后期维护成本仍然较高,使用时存在一定的局限性。2. ...
  • 机器视觉方面有哪些好的开发平台,各有什么特点?
    答:1. Halcon:广泛应用于机器视觉领域。2. VisionPro:提供丰富的视觉处理功能。3. Keyence:适用于各种工业检测场合。4. NIVision:西门子推出的视觉开发平台。5. MIL:Matrox Imaging Library,提供丰富的图像处理功能。6. OpenCV:开源的计算机视觉库,适用于各种操作系统和平台。
  • 机器视觉开发软件有哪些
    答:1. OpenCV:OpenCV是一个开源的计算机视觉库,提供了丰富的图像处理和计算机视觉算法。它支持多种编程语言,如C++、Python等,并可在多个平台上使用。2. TensorFlow:TensorFlow是一个流行的深度学习框架,提供了强大的图像处理和机器学习功能。它可以用于构建和训练卷积神经网络(CNN)等模型,用于图像分类、...
  • Halcon软件与Matlab软件有什么异同?两者间的优势各是什么?
    答:所以往往很耗时。随着各类机器视觉软件的开发,各种机器视觉软件包也相继产生,HALCON就是一个比较强大的机器视觉软件,功能比较全,在HDevelop环境下开发比较容易,执行速度也较快。除此之外,HALCON也可以集成到其他开发环境下,这样可以节约底层开发时间,直接有效地运用它的函数库,可以产生很好的效果。
  • 机器视觉方面有哪些好的开发平台?各有什么特点
    答:1. VisionMax软件:该软件界面简洁易用,支持全可视化操作,提供开放接口,能够方便地创建多种视觉工具。2. Halcon软件:其架构优化了机器视觉、医学图像以及图像分析应用的快速开发。
  • 常用机器视觉软件有哪些
    答:VisionPro是由美国Cognex公司开发的图像处理软件。它集成了丰富的视觉工具和算法,适用于工业自动化和机器视觉应用。VisionPro可以与其他视觉库(如Halcon和OpenCV)集成,共同进行图像处理和视觉检测。其优势在于高度集成化、用户友好界面和广泛应用,但劣势是作为商业软件且功能相对有限。五、OpenCV OpenCV是一...
  • 机器视觉方面有哪些好的开发平台?各有什么特点_机器视觉的应用有...
    答:1. Visual C++ (VC):作为最广泛使用的平台之一,VC提供了强大的功能和灵活性。它与Windows操作系统兼容良好,运行性能优越。开发者可以选择编写自己的算法,也可以利用现有的工具包。大多数工具包都支持VC开发,因此它成为了许多开发者的首选。2. C#:这种语言相对容易上手,尤其是在开发界面功能时,与...
  • 机器视觉哪种软件比较好(机器视觉软件排名)
    答:1、以Halcon,VisionPro为代表的传统机器视觉软件,通过调用各种算法因子,针对目标特征,定制化设置各种参数。其擅长解决以测量为主的定量问题,和判断有无的简单问题,但对复杂检测类的需求,漏检率/误检率较高。虽然软件价格一降再降,国产软件售价仅几千元甚至免费,但前期开发和后期维护成本较高,在...